Enjoy these irresistible caramelized banana bites, stuffed with creamy peanut butter and sprinkled with crunchy granola. These bite-sized treats are the perfect combination of sweet, salty, and crunchy, making them an ideal snack for any time of the day.

ingredients

  • 3 ripe bananas
  • 3 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 3 tablespoons creamy peanut butter
  • 1/4 cup granola

steps

  1. 1.

    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).

  2. 2.

    Cut each banana into 1-inch thick slices and set aside.

  3. 3.

    In a small sa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at.

  4. 4.

    Add the brown sugar to the melted butter and stir until combined.

  5. 5.

    Dip each banana slice into the caramel mixture and place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.

  6. 6.

    Bake the banana slices for about 10 minutes, or until the caramelized surface turns golden brown.

  7. 7.

    Remove the baking sheet from the oven and allow the bananas to cool for a few minutes.

  8. 8.

    Spread a small amount of creamy peanut butter on the bottom side of a caramelized banana slice.

  9. 9.

    Sprinkle some granola on top of the peanut butter and cover it with another caramelized banana slice.

  10. 10.

    Repeat the process with the remaining banana slices.

  11. 11.

    Serve immediately or refrigerate for a refreshing chilled snack.
